Early Career and Youth Development

Neymar's football foundation was built through youth structures in Brazil, where technical creativity and tactical adaptability were emphasized early. He progressed through academy systems before reaching senior professional football, and this phase shaped core attributes such as close control, dribbling, and decision-making under pressure. These fundamentals became central to his identity as an attacking player and influenced how clubs and national teams approached his development.

Playing Style and Tactical Role

Neymar is widely recognized for his technical skills, spatial awareness, and versatility in attack. His playing style combines dribbling, passing, and finishing, allowing him to operate across forward areas and central midfield spaces. Coaches have used him in roles that maximize creativity, chance creation, and defensive transitions, making his presence relevant in multiple tactical systems.

  • Primary position: Forward, second striker, winger
  • Signature traits: Close dribbling, off-the-ball movement, shot accuracy
  • Team contributions: Goal scoring, chance creation, pressing, link-up play
